Comparing The Dubbing Between 3D Anime Vs 2D Anime With The Beastars English Voice Actors



During the first in person panel with the Beastars English voice actors, Jonah Scott discusses how his voice acting career relates to Legoshi in many ways, and discusses how they weirded out the director while recording for the anime.
